计算机应用 | 古代文学 | 市场营销 | 生命科学 | 交通物流 | 财务管理 | 历史学 | 毕业 | 哲学 | 政治 | 财税 | 经济 | 金融 | 审计 | 法学 | 护理学 | 国际经济与贸易
计算机软件 | 新闻传播 | 电子商务 | 土木工程 | 临床医学 | 旅游管理 | 建筑学 | 文学 | 化学 | 数学 | 物理 | 地理 | 理工 | 生命 | 文化 | 企业管理 | 电子信息工程
计算机网络 | 语言文学 | 信息安全 | 工程力学 | 工商管理 | 经济管理 | 计算机 | 机电 | 材料 | 医学 | 药学 | 会计 | 硕士 | 法律 | MBA
现当代文学 | 英美文学 | 通讯工程 | 网络工程 | 行政管理 | 公共管理 | 自动化 | 艺术 | 音乐 | 舞蹈 | 美术 | 本科 | 教育 | 英语 |

基子Atmega103微控制器的家庭信息终端的设计(2)

2017-07-03 01:09
导读:2.1 触摸屏控制器 实际应用中,终端采用的触摸屏控制器是AD7843。AD7843是AD公司生产的一款专用于4线电阻式触摸屏的模/数转换器。AD7843有12位或8位可选

2.1 触摸屏控制器

实际应用中,终端采用的触摸屏控制器是AD7843。AD7843是AD公司生产的一款专用于4线电阻式触摸屏的模/数转换器。AD7843有12位或8位可选的两种工作模式,具有单一电源供电、完全低功耗模式、转换速度快等特点。图3是AD7843与4线电阻式触摸屏典型接口图。

图3中,PENIRQ引脚在触摸屏被点击后立即产生一个宽度约为4个DCLK的负脉冲向主控单片机申请中断。主控单片机响应此中断后,通过DIN引脚将控制字写入AD7843的控制寄存器,以启动一次转换。转换结束后,BUSY也将产生一个负脉冲向主控单片机申请中断,响应中断后主控单片机将转换结果由DOUT引脚读出。读出的结果经过转换后就是触摸屏上被点击点的坐标。

在终端设计中,采用功能图标表示终端具体功能操作。这样通过点击触摸屏对应位置下LCD上显示的功能图标,可以选择相应的功能操作,从而可以对终端进行相应的操作。

2.2 LCD接口电路

终端采用160x160(dots)的LCD作为显示界面。LCD控制器选用SEIKOEPSON公司的SED1335。SED1335具有较强功能的I/O缓冲器、指令丰富、4位数据并行发送且驱动能力强,可实现图形和文本混合显示。

单片机对LCD采用直接访问方式,将LCD作为存储器直接与单片机的总线相连接。LCD控制器的数据总线与单片机的数据总线相连,并且由单片机给出控制器的片选及寄存器选择信号。此外,LCD的单片机接口时序与SED1335接口电路的时序采用Intel8080时序。

2.3 无线数据传输

终端将选择的具体功能操作按通信协议的规定组织成数据命令帧通过无线数传模块发送至室内控制器RC。系统采用nRF401作为无线数据收发的控制芯片。nRF401是Nordic公司推出的一款工作在433MHz、具有双通道的、数据传输速率最高可达20kbps的无线射频数据收发芯片。而且nRF401做到了单个芯片实现FSK信号的收发,其引脚电平为CMOS电平,可以直接与单片机串行口通信。

(科教论文网 Lw.nsEAc.com编辑整理)

上一篇:嵌入式指纹识别系统开发 下一篇:没有了